Think about all the traffic that goes through your house on a daily basis. All of the dust, dirt, pet hair, and other elements that are around landing on and entering your carpet. There are many factors to the amount of dirt, dust, and dander that make it into your home and on your carpet. Many studies have shown that vacuuming on a regular basis, say three to five times per week, can only remove up to 79% of your dry soils. Lain's Carpet Care recommends you have your carpets deep cleaned by a professional every six to twelve months and maybe more often if you have a larger family or pet. Having your carpets cleaned in your home or rental property will help remove the odors and other allergens, which will make a difference in the overall appearance of your carpet and have a healthier environment. Homeowners and Landlords will inevitably end up with a carpet that lasts longer save a ton of money.
